Cabochon Sapphire Diamonds Pendant on Chain
£1,800
Heritagem presents:
This modern 18kt white gold pendant is set with a beautiful deep navy blue sapphire of 4ct approximately surrounding with brilliant cut diamonds. The pendant comes with its 18kt white gold chain. It is in very good condition.

Description
Weight: 6gr
Metal: 18kt white Gold
Stones: 1 Sapphire
• Cut: Cabochon Pear Shape
• Total Carat Weight: 4ct approximately
Others: 52 diamonds
• Cut: Brilliant
• Total carat weight: 1.20ct approximately
• Colour: G/H
• Clarity: VS
Condition: Very Good
Hallmarks: Italian 750
Dimensions: Height: 18.99mm / 0.74in
Width/ Face: 15.59mm / 0.61in
Chain length: 40cm / 16in

Heritagem presents:
This ravishing medal is made in 18kt yellow gold. It features the profile of a beautiful young veiled woman looking to the left. She is surrounded with seed pearls. We can see the signature on the left side: E. Dropsy (1848 – 1923) a French medallist. He is considered today as the religious medallist with the purest design. It is controlled with the French eagle’s head.

This ravishing necklace is a real testimony of the Edwardian period. It features a platinum pendant adorned with 2 ribbons and garland. It set with a rose cut diamond in its center, with 2 table cut diamonds and rose cut diamonds. The dangling diamond on the bottom is slightly included. There is an approximate total carat weight of 2ct. It was perfectly well handcrafted. The chain is made in 18kt gold and it measures 40 cm long. It is secured with a security chain. The necklace weighs 8,7gr and it is in very good antique condition. The pendant measures 38,72 (1,52) by 34,43(1,35) mm (inch). You can add a brooch pin on the back.
It was made at the very beginning of the 20th century in France during the Belle Epoque (Edwardian era). The clasp is marked with the French eagle's head and it was tested as platinum for the pendant. This necklace is absolutely ravishing , it is very refined.
